Preparing Your Device for Resale
Proper preparation can significantly increase your device’s resale value. Follow these steps:
- Perform a factory reset to erase all personal data.
- Clean the device thoroughly, including screen and ports.
- Ensure the device is free from scratches and dents.
- Gather original accessories such as the charger, cables, and box.
- Check that the device is unlocked and functioning properly.
Pricing Strategies
Setting the right price is vital. Research similar listings on popular marketplaces like eBay, Swappa, or Facebook Marketplace. Consider the device’s condition, storage capacity, and whether it includes accessories. Typically, older Pixel 8 Pro 256GB models sell for 60-80% of their original retail price.
Effective Listing Tips
Create compelling listings to attract buyers. Use clear, high-quality photos showing all angles, including the device’s serial number and condition details. Write a detailed description covering:
- Device condition (new, like new, used)
- Any scratches or damages
- Included accessories
- Unlock status
- Reason for selling
Choosing the Right Selling Platform
Select platforms with high traffic and buyer trust. Popular options include eBay for auction-style sales, Swappa for tech-specific sales, and Facebook Marketplace for local transactions. Each platform has its own fee structure and audience, so choose accordingly.
Safety Tips for Transactions
Protect yourself during the selling process:
- Use secure payment methods like PayPal or platform-specific escrow services.
- Avoid accepting wire transfers or direct bank deposits from unknown buyers.
- Meet in public places if conducting local transactions.
- Verify payment receipt before releasing the device.
